Cheapest Available Spring Hill Apartments for Rent and Nearby

 

The cheapest available apartment rental in Spring Hill, KS is a 1 Bed unit found at Governors Court in the Seville neighborhood priced from $925. Jefferson on the Lake in the Amber Hills Estates neighborhood has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 1 Bed apartment currently listed from $1,059. Best Value Apartments for Rent in Spring Hill, KS and Nearby

As of June 09, 2025 the best value apartment in the Spring Hill area is the $1.47 price per square foot 2 Bed TownHomes Model at Oak Woods Townhomes in the in the The Meadows neighborhood starting from $1,855. The second greatest value Spring Hill apartment is the 2BUlt Model at Chestnut Heights starting at $1,995 with a $1.60 price per square foot in the Amber Hills Estates neighborhood.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Spring Hill Apartments

What is the Cheapest Studio apartment in Spring Hill?

Currently the most affordable Cheap Studio Apartment in Spring Hill is at Arrello listed at $1,081.

How much is rent for a Cheap One Bedroom Spring Hill Apartment?

The lowest price for a Cheap One Bedroom Spring Hill Apartment is $925 at Governors Court.

What is the lowest price for a Cheap Two Bedroom Spring Hill Apartment for rent?

Today's best deal for a Cheap Two Bedroom Apartment in Spring Hill is starting from $1,125 at Governors Court.

What is the most affordable Spring Hill Three Bedroom Apartment?

The best deal on a cheap Spring Hill Three Bedroom Apartment rental is at Saddlewood Apartments and starts from $1,810.
